!OBIT: Bemidji Pioneer, 21 Mar 1993:
  Louella K. Beck, 80, of Bemidji, died Friday, March 19, 1993, in the North
Country Regional Hospital in Bemidji.
  Funeral services will be at 2 p.m. Monday at the Olson-Schwartz Funeral Home,
with the Rev. James Vadis officiating.  Visitation will be one hour prior to
services at the funeral.  Interment will be at Evergreen Cemetary in Northern
Township.
  Pallbearers will be Robert Foy, Ron Beaulieu, Cecil Louks, Donald Hill, Craig
Limbocker, and Robby Beaulieu.
  She was born in Kelliher on April 23, 1912 to Robert and Mary Foy.  She grew
up and attended school in Beltrami County and has lived in the Bemidji area
most of her life.
  She is survived bya special friend, Arthur Westrum of Bemidji; four sons,
Myron of Turtle River, Darwin of Grants Pass, Ore., Gordon and Gary, both of
Bemidji; three daughters, Marilyn (Charles) Potucek of Salem, Ore., Marlene
(Ted) Knox of Bemidji, and Kay Kemmer of Bemidji, and one special niece, Margie
Manley of Minneapolis.
  She was preceded in death by her husband, three sons, and one
daughter.
